Abstract

624,760. Swivelling couplings. BRITISH THOMSON-HOUSTON CO., Ltd. July 8, 1947, No. 18056. Convention date, Aug. 12, 1943. [Class 38 (i)] [Also in Group XL (c)] A coaxial cable 42 passes through the tubular inner conductor 51 of a coaxial line 50, and couplings are formed in all four conductors so as to permit relative rotation of two sections of the lines. Outer conductor 50, Fig. 8, is formed with a capacity coupling formed by a quarter-wave extension 56 of fixed tube 55 overlapping tube 50, and a spaced quarterwave sleeve 57 brazed to tube 50. Alignment is ensured by connecting conductor 50 to rotatable tube 60 which is mechanically coupled to fixed tube 55 by a bearing 47. A similar capacity joint is formed at the upper part of inner conductor 51 by two quarter wavelengths 65, 67, Fig. 9, overlapped by an outer section 68. The braided outer cable of line 42 is supported in an enclosing steel tube 70 which makes rotatable connection with contact fingers 73 connected to an outlet bush 83. The inner conductor 78 rotates in a split socket 79 carried by a centre outlet conductor 80.
